2013-05-14 50 views
1

我試圖綁定JSON格式的數據時,我試圖相同的代碼在.aspx頁面其不拋出任何錯誤,但中的jqGrid CSHTML一頁一頁的投擲錯誤的jqGrid不是function.i cannt能看到grid.My代碼的設計是這樣的`在mvc4 CSHTML頁工作,但在aspx頁面工作正常時jqgrid`不是一個函數錯誤

<script language="javascript" type="text/javascript"> 
$(document).ready(function() { 
    var gridimgpath = 'themes/basic/images'; 
    $("#projectList").jqGrid({ 
     datatype: "json", 
     height: 150, 
     colNames: ['WorkSpaceName', 'Id'], 
     colModel: [ 
    { name: 'Id', index: 'Id', width: 600 }, 
    { name: 'WorkSpaceName', index: 'WorkSpaceName', width: 600 }, 

    ], 
     imgpath: gridimgpath, 
     multiselect: true, 
     ignoreCase: true, 
     hidegrid: false, 
     caption: "WorkSpace Name", 
     pager: '#gridpager', 
     rowNum: 10, 
     viewrecords: true, 
     rowList: [10, 20, 30, 40] 
    }); 
    $.ajax({ 
     url: 'OauthVerifierNew', 
     type: 'GET', 
     dataType: "json", 
     contentType: 'application/json; charset=utf-8', 
     data: {}, 
     beforeSend: function() { 
      alert("hello") 
     }, 
     success: function (response) { 
      $("#projectList").setGridParam({ data: response }).trigger("reloadGrid"); 
     }, 
     error: function (error) { 
      alert(error); 


     } 
    }); 
    $("#projectList").jqGrid('filterToolbar', { stringResult: true, searchOnEnter: false, defaultSearch: "cn" }); 

}); 

+0

我更換了腳本文件,它的工作F9 – user2322397 2013-05-14 13:51:47

+0

你把jqGrid的依賴已經aspx頁面後? – Olrac 2013-05-16 09:13:05

回答

-1

錯誤,如

的jqGrid不函數

您不添加您網頁上jqgrid.js或jqGrid的文件,

檢查網頁的「來源」,無論是在CSHTML和aspx頁面

並檢查瀏覽器也是如此,如果jqGrid的是真的添加與否。

+0

有人不明白問題和答案大聲笑..他用「我替換腳本文件夾後,其工作F9」的意思是什麼????? jqgrid沒有完美添加..哈哈下來選民... – 2013-05-15 06:16:56

相關問題